If you dont have any taxable benefits in kind (like a company car), or employee expenses, or state pension, this is your only or main job and you have no other sources of untaxed income, then the standard 1257L code should mean you are paying the right amount of tax in 2020-21. If this is your first job since moving to the UK and you have not received any form of taxable income since becoming a UK tax resident, Statement A would be the most appropriate option. Statement A applies if it is your new employees first job in the current tax year (since 6 April) and theyve not been receiving taxable Jobseeker's Allowance, Employment and Support Allowance, taxable Incapacity Benefit, state pension or occupational pension. Statement B applies if this is now your new employees only job, but theyve had another job since 6 April and don't have a P45. they dont have a P45 to give to you (this may be because its their first job or theyre starting a new job without leaving a previous one), their personal details are different to those on their P45, they have been sent to work temporarily in the UK by an overseas employer, personal details, including their name, full address and date of birth, details of any student loans or postgraduate loans, passport number (if they are sent to work temporarily in the UK by an overseas employee), details of any income received in the current tax year from another job, a pension or from Jobseekers Allowance, Employment and Support Allowance or Incapacity Benefit. This code should be correct if you are a basic rate taxpayer and all of your personal allowance for the year is being fully used against earnings from another employment or pension.
